It is with great sadness that we announce the sudden and unexpected passing of Susan Isabel Matthews of Antigonish on Tuesday, May 21, 2019, in St. Martha’s Regional Hospital, Antigonish at the age of 55.

Born in Inverness, she was a daughter of the late William "Billy" and Mae (MacArthur) Matthews.

Susan had a great love of the outdoors – biking, snowshoeing, walking, and hiking.  She enjoyed spending time with her close friends in Antigonish and will be greatly missed by her dog, Maddie.

Susan is survived by her only son, Kyle (Anne), whom she loved dearly; sisters, Cathy Matthews (AJ), Port Hood, and Donna (Duncan) MacLennan, River Denys; brother, Artie (Joanie), West Bay Road; and numerous aunts, uncles, nieces, nephews, and cousins.

Predeceased by maternal grandparents, Lloyd and Isabelle MacArthur, paternal grandparents, Russell and Maudie Matthews, and a brother in infancy.

Visitation will be held Monday from 2 to 5 and 7 to 9pm in C.L. Curry Funeral Home, 135 College Street, Antigonish.  Funeral service will be held Tuesday in St. James United Church, Antigonish, at 11:00am, Reverend Peter Smith presiding.  Burial in Upper River Denys Cemetery.
